Problem

Existing devices for locking out chain wheel operated valves are cumbersome and inefficient, making it difficult to secure and contain the chain, especially when valves are located overhead, posing a risk of accidental activation of power sources.

Innovation Solution

A compact lockout device with a body, pivotally attached lid, and a downwardly extending pin that secures the chain loop, combined with a closure mechanism for positive locking and optional features like apertures for drainage and a handle for ease of use.

Data Source

PatentUS9422751B1Lockout device for a chain wheel operated valve
Publication Date: 2016.08.23 ROTO HAMMER IND INC

AI summary

The lockout device has a body with one or more continuous sidewalls, an open end and a bottom defining an interior volume. It also has a lid pivotally attached to at least one of the sidewalls and moveable between an open and closed position. The lid is located to cover at least a portion of the open end of the body when in the closed position. The device also has a closure mechanism capable of holding the lid in a closed position. A pin extends at a downward angle from one of the side across a gap in the lid.
